Dark
THE END IS THE BEGINNING AND THE BEGINNING IS THE END
In a small town of Winden weird things starts to happen after the death of Michael Kahnwald. His son Jonas Kahnwald who turns to therapy after the incident finds out some dark secrets about the town.
The story revolves around four families who are Kahnwald, Nielson, Doppler and Tiedemann, who are connected to one other in a weird way. After the disappearance of Mikkel Nielson, Jonas goes on a search mission on him. This is where he discovers that he could travel in time through the cave which is connected to the power plant of the town.
The interesting part of this story is we come face to face with various characters who are revealed to be one individual. For instance, we see three variations of Jonas (The Stranger and Adam) and Martha (older Martha and Eva) who are main leads of the series. Characters like Noah and Claudia brings in suspense factor along with giving the audience the knowledge of the family history.
Initially the time travel too place in three eras which are 1954, 1987 and 2020 but later 2053 which was stated as apocalypse world and 1921 were also introduced. Along with this we find out there is another universe in existence which is Eva’s world. Adam’s world which follows Sic Mundus which is dark, Eva’s world follows Erit Lux which is light. Introduction of another character in three versions is again made who is known as The Unknow who is Adam and Eva’s son and acts as a knot between two worlds.
The prime story of world 3 takes place in the years 2019 and 2052 which is also referred as apocalypse world. Along with this storyline in 1888 is also shown to the audience.
It is revealed that the original time machine was made by H. G. Tannhaus after the death of his son, daughter in law and granddaughter. Building of this time machine lead the world to split into two parts and the original world was divided in two.
Jonas and Martha, with the help of Claudia figures out in order to stop the apocalypse to happen in both worlds they need to save Tannhaus’s family and stop him from making the time machine to bring them back. By doing so the two of them are able to break the knot and the world is never torn in two parts.
